Author: mjg
Date: Thu Feb  4 04:22:18 2016
New Revision: 295232
URL: https://svnweb.freebsd.org/changeset/base/295232

Log:
  fork: pass arguments to fork1 in a dedicated structure
  
  Suggested by: kib

Modified:
  head/sys/compat/cloudabi/cloudabi_proc.c
  head/sys/compat/linux/linux_fork.c
  head/sys/kern/init_main.c
  head/sys/kern/kern_fork.c
  head/sys/kern/kern_kthread.c
  head/sys/sys/proc.h

Modified: head/sys/sys/proc.h
==============================================================================
--- head/sys/sys/proc.h Thu Feb  4 03:55:41 2016        (r295231)
+++ head/sys/sys/proc.h Thu Feb  4 04:22:18 2016        (r295232)
@@ -907,6 +907,15 @@ struct     proc *pfind_locked(pid_t pid);
 struct pgrp *pgfind(pid_t);            /* Find process group by id. */
 struct proc *zpfind(pid_t);            /* Find zombie process by id. */
 
+struct fork_req {
+       int             fr_flags;
+       int             fr_pages;
+       struct proc     **fr_procp;
+       int             *fr_pd_fd;
+       int             fr_pd_flags;
+       struct filecaps *fr_pd_fcaps;
+};
+
 /*
  * pget() flags.
  */
@@ -930,8 +939,7 @@ int enterpgrp(struct proc *p, pid_t pgid
 int    enterthispgrp(struct proc *p, struct pgrp *pgrp);
 void   faultin(struct proc *p);
 void   fixjobc(struct proc *p, struct pgrp *pgrp, int entering);
-int    fork1(struct thread *, int, int, struct proc **, int *, int,
-           struct filecaps *);
+int    fork1(struct thread *, struct fork_req *);
 void   fork_exit(void (*)(void *, struct trapframe *), void *,
            struct trapframe *);
 void   fork_return(struct thread *, struct trapframe *);
